GENERAL SITUATION: A WEAK COLD FRONT WILL MOVE INTO THE NORTHWEST BAHAMAS MONDAY NIGHT AND DISSIPATE. MEANWHILE, A FRONTAL BOUNDARY WILL STALLED SOUTH OF THE SOUTHEAST BAHAMAS LATE MONDAY AND WILL GRADUALLY LIFT NORTH ON WEDNESDAY BRINGING SHOWER ACTVITY TO THE CENTRAL AND SOUTHEAST ISLANDS THROUGH FRIDAY. A HIGH PRESSURE CENTER WILL BUILD EASTWARD ACROSS THE BAHAMAS ON TUESDAY, AND SETTLE NORTH OF THE ISLANDS THROUGH SATURDAY. A SURFACE TROUGH WILL MOVE WESTWARD THROUGH THE ISLANDS SATURDAY AND SUNDAY.
